Role overview
Goldman Sachs is looking for an Applied AI Researcher to join its Applied Artificial Intelligence research group in London. The role sits within the engineering function and focuses on advancing the use of modern AI and machine learning methods across the firm. You will work on practical solutions that support production systems and help solve complex problems in a financial environment.
The position offers the chance to contribute across several AI and ML areas, including machine learning, deep learning, natural language processing, information retrieval, time series analysis, and recommender systems. The work blends quantitative research with applied engineering to build systems that are reliable, scalable, and useful in real-world trading and investment workflows.
What you will do
- Work closely with teammates to improve machine learning systems and production applications.
- Design, test, and evaluate AI and ML software solutions.
- Write, maintain, and improve high-quality code that is ready for production use.
- Take ownership of cross-functional initiatives and provide technical direction when needed.
- Develop reusable libraries and frameworks that support dependable and testable systems.
- Represent Goldman Sachs at conferences and in open-source communities.
Required background
- Strong practical experience building and maintaining large-scale Python applications.
- A Master’s or Ph.D. in Computer Science, Machine Learning, Mathematics, Statistics, Physics, Engineering, Quantitative Finance, or a closely related field, or equivalent industry experience.
- At least 1 to 3 years of industry experience in AI/ML.
- Solid experience working on software for quantitative investment workflows across equities, fixed income, or multi-asset strategies.
